Tips for Dry Creek Residents
1. **Plan for Distance**: Since junk removal services might travel from surrounding areas, schedule pickups in advance, especially during busy seasons like spring cleaning or after storms. Many companies serve Dry Creek but may charge a small travel fee—ask upfront to avoid surprises.
2. **Separate Your Items**: In Louisiana, recycling and disposal rules vary. Separate metals, electronics, and hazardous materials (like paint or batteries) from general junk. Some local providers offer eco-friendly disposal, which helps our beautiful bayous and wetlands stay clean.
3. **Consider Donations**: Before you junk everything, think about donating usable furniture, appliances, or tools to local charities or thrift stores in nearby communities. It's a great way to give back and reduce waste.
4. **Get Multiple Quotes**: Contact a few services for estimates—phone or online quotes are common. Describe your items clearly (e.g., "an old sofa and two bags of yard waste") to get accurate pricing. In Dry Creek, average costs for a truckload range from $150-$300, depending on volume.
